Social Justice and Social Security Committee
Meeting Agenda
8th Meeting, 2021
- Date: Thursday, October 28, 2021
- Session: 6
- Location: T4.40-CR2 The Fairfax Somerville Room
- Start time: 09:00am
- Published: Thursday, November 4, 2021 10:48am
1 Subordinate legislation:
The Committee will take evidence on the Disability Assistance for Children and Young People (Scotland) Amendment Regulations 2021 from—

2 Subordinate legislation:
Ben Macpherson (Minister for Social Security and Local Government) to move—
S6M-01183—That the Social Justice and Social Security Committee recommends that the Disability Assistance for Children and Young People (Scotland) Amendment Regulations 2021 be approved.
3 Subordinate legislation:
The Committee will take evidence on the Winter Heating Assistance for Children and Young People (Scotland) Amendment Regulations 2021 from—

4 Subordinate legislation:
Ben Macpherson (Minister for Social Security and Local Government) to move—
S6M-01319—That the Social Justice and Social Security Committee recommends that the Winter Heating Assistance for Children and Young People (Scotland) Amendment Regulations 2021 be approved.
5 Budget Scrutiny 2022-23: (Private)
The Committee will consider a draft pre-budget scrutiny letter.
